Primarily secreted by the cardiomyocytes in the heart ventricles, BNP is released into the bloodstream in response to increased ventricular filling pressure or volume, essentially acting as an indicator of how hard the heart is working. Understanding BNP and its related markers, such as NT-proBNP, is crucial for diagnosing and managing various cardiac conditions, particularly heart failure.
BNP is a 32-amino-acid peptide that belongs to the natriuretic peptide family. It functions as a cardiac hormone and is synthesized and released into the blood in response to conditions that cause ventricular stretch or volume overload. Both BNP and NT-proBNP are valuable in assessing cardiac status.
The B-type natriuretic peptide (BNP) test is a common blood test that measures the levels of BNP protein in your blood. This test is mainly used to help diagnose or rule out heart failure in individuals presenting with symptoms such as shortness of breath.

This diagnostic approach allows for the rule-out of heart failure in many cases, preventing unnecessary investigations and treatments.
While heart failure is the primary condition associated with elevated BNP, it's important to note that BNP levels may be elevated by factors other than CHF. These can include acute coronary syndrome, pulmonary embolism, shock, atrial arrhythmia, and severe hypertension. Therefore, a comprehensive clinical evaluation is always necessary alongside BNP testing.
Research has also indicated that reducing dietary salt can lead to decreased B-type natriuretic peptide levels, highlighting the interconnectedness of lifestyle factors and cardiovascular markers.
